Concrete foundation sealing services involve applying specialized coatings or sealants to the exterior or interior surfaces of a building’s foundation. The primary goal is to create a protective barrier that prevents water infiltration, reduces moisture penetration, and minimizes the risk of cracking or deterioration over time. These services often include cleaning the foundation surface thoroughly before applying the sealant, ensuring proper adhesion and effectiveness. The process may vary depending on the type of foundation and the specific needs of the property, but the focus remains on enhancing the durability and longevity of the foundation structure.
Sealing foundations addresses common problems such as water seepage, basement flooding, and mold growth caused by excess moisture. It can also help prevent the development of cracks that might lead to more serious structural issues if left untreated. By creating a moisture-resistant barrier, foundation sealing services contribute to maintaining a stable interior environment and protecting the property’s overall integrity. This preventative approach is especially valuable in areas prone to heavy rainfall, fluctuating temperatures, or high humidity, where moisture intrusion is a frequent concern.

Material and Surface Preparation - Costs typically range from $300 to $800 depending on the size of the area and the extent of surface cleaning needed. Proper preparation ensures effective sealing and long-lasting results. Local pros can assess specific project requirements for accurate estimates.
Sealing Material Costs - The price for sealing materials usually falls between $1.50 and $4.00 per square foot. Higher-quality sealants or specialized formulations may increase the overall cost. Service providers can recommend suitable options based on the foundation type.
Labor and Application Fees - Labor charges for sealing a concrete foundation generally range from $2.00 to $5.00 per square foot. The total cost depends on the foundation size and complexity of the application process. Local contractors can provide detailed quotes for specific projects.
Additional Services and Repairs - Costs for any necessary repairs or additional waterproofing services can add $200 to $1,000 or more. These may include crack sealing or surface repairs prior to sealing. Pros can evaluate the foundation to determine any extra work needed for optimal sealing results.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is concrete foundation sealing? Concrete foundation sealing involves applying protective coatings or sealants to prevent moisture infiltration and protect the foundation from water damage.
Why should I consider sealing my foundation? Sealing can help reduce water seepage, prevent cracks, and extend the lifespan of the foundation in areas prone to moisture issues.
How often does a foundation need to be sealed? The frequency of sealing depends on the type of sealant used and local conditions, but typically every few years is recommended.
What types of sealants are used for foundation sealing? Common sealants include waterproof coatings, epoxy-based sealants, and elastomeric sealants designed for concrete surfaces.
